boost c++框架的用户体验

boost可以从 http://www.boost.org/users/download/  下载,其实跳转到 sf.net进行下载了。

没有中文版本的帮助文档就不说了,对于国人来说挺糟糕的。有个项目是翻译的,不过也没什么进展:http://code.google.com/p/boost-doc-zh/ 。chm格式的帮助文档,是我的最爱,太方便了。pdf的 html方式的 都没有chm的好,chm本质也是 对 html的打包,但是多了 查找 索引 收藏 等功能,目录树也很好。真想做一个 类似 chm的开源web项目。

boost从他的现在 可以看到,非常糟糕的设计,boost_1_50_0.7z也有 44.8 MB (47,059,966 字节) 大小。不必说解压后了。解压后,看到的感觉好像 帮助文档? 那 doc 目录下的那些呢?http://sourceforge.net/projects/boost/files/boost-docs/ 都是pdf, 比如 boost_1_47_doc_src.zip 64.0 MB (67,156,409 字节),简直让我崩溃。两者 看起来 相同的东西挺多的,或许是 源码 包含了 doc_src了。两部分 为什么放在一起 进行管理呢?而且 外国人喜欢pdf格式,虽说 chm是微软的格式,或许 那些人都使用 *nix,并且坚决反对使用GUI(类似windows的一切东西他们都抵制),对于这群人真是无语,只要好用就行了,干嘛那么追求专业化的效率。他们制作的文档 是 以你就是开发者的角度来制作的,而不是浏览者。

boost许多文件夹下都有Jamfile.v2,但是搜索bjam 基本没啥有用信息,但是在文档 初略的浏览了一下,根本找不到bjam软件的信息。我是在windows下,如果是在linux依旧矛盾的。

既然是跨平台 为什么不为 windows 平台做点工作呢?后来还是 在 http://sourceforge.net/projects/boost/files/boost-jam/3.1.18/ 看到了,这里有nt86的可执行文件。

算了 开源不错了,还指望 能做的多么 贴近用户么? 只能 低效率的 看他们的文档,慢慢琢磨了。

网上搜索一下 编译boost 还是有不少文章的,可以参考。那些最重要的东西,却不是boost文档所提供的信息。他们提供的信息也是乱七八糟的。

http://blog.csdn.net/dainiao01/article/details/6337125

原文链接: https://www.cnblogs.com/ayanmw/archive/2012/07/24/2606401.html

欢迎关注

微信关注下方公众号,第一时间获取干货硬货;公众号内回复【pdf】免费获取数百本计算机经典书籍

    boost c++框架的用户体验

原创文章受到原创版权保护。转载请注明出处:https://www.ccppcoding.com/archives/56478

非原创文章文中已经注明原地址,如有侵权,联系删除

关注公众号【高性能架构探索】,第一时间获取最新文章

转载文章受原作者版权保护。转载请注明原作者出处!

(0)
上一篇 2023年2月9日 上午7:23
下一篇 2023年2月9日 上午7:23

相关推荐